Evaluating Tree Health: When to Reach Out to the Experts

Assessing the health of trees is an essential step in sustaining a safe and thriving landscape. Homeowners should consistently inspect their trees for signs of distress, such as wilting leaves, unusual growth patterns, or noticeable decay. Factors like pests, diseases, and environmental challenges can significantly influence a tree's vitality. If a tree shows significant leaning, exposed roots, or dead branches, it may present a safety concern and necessitate professional assessment.

Contacting tree experts can deliver a comprehensive assessment of tree health, detecting issues that may not be readily apparent. Professionals use specialized knowledge and tools to assess root systems, bark conditions, and overall structural integrity. Furthermore, they can propose appropriate actions, whether it be treatment or removal. Swift intervention is essential to prevent further damage to the tree or surrounding landscape, maintaining the safety and aesthetic appeal of the property.

The Tree Removal Process: What to Expect

Hiring trained tree removal specialists creates the foundation for a well-organized and methodical approach to the removal process. At the outset, the specialists conduct a thorough assessment of the tree and its surroundings, determining the safest and most effective method for removal. They assess factors such as tree health, proximity to structures, and potential hazards.

After the assessment is finished, the team develops a complete plan. This may include safeguarding the area, using suitable equipment, and employing techniques such as sectional felling or crane removal for sizeable trees. The main removal process includes cutting the tree down in a systematic manner, guaranteeing that it falls in the desired direction.

Following removal, the specialists will often grind the stump and remove debris, leaving the area neat. Transparent communication throughout the process keeps property owners well-informed, ensuring that expectations are fulfilled and safety remains a top priority. This professional approach decreases risks and disruption to the surrounding landscape.

How Much Will Professional Tree Removal Typically Cost?

Professional tree removal generally costs in the range of $200 to $2,000, determined by elements such as tree size, location, and intricacy of the job. Additional services, including stump grinding, may result in extra charges as well.

Do I Need a Permit for Tree Removal?

Whether you need a permit for tree removal varies by location. Typically, homeowners should examine local regulations or consult with municipal authorities to determine if a permit is necessary before beginning tree removal.
